Mechanisms and feedback consequences of shrub expansion following long-term increases
in winter snow depth in northern Alaska: a legacy for IPY
Data
Access:
-
2007_CO2_Flux_Welker - This is a study of how different snow regimes effect CO2 exchange in tussock tundra and whether there are shifts in ecosystem C cycling when facets of "drift" effects are isolated. The study is part of the IPY program and is aimed at measuring the state of Arctic tundra.
